Unai Emery receives good news ahead of their match against Manchester City
Arsenal will on Sunday face Manchester City which is currently second on the Premier League table.
Arsenal will on Sunday face Manchester City at the Etihad Stadium and the gooners will be worried about this game because they are currently in an injury crisis in their defensive area. Unai Emery has however received some good news as the latest team news reveal that Laurent Koscielny and Ainsley Maitland-Niles have returned to full training ahead of their trip to Manchester.
Arsenal defender Laurent Koscielny got injured in Arsenal’s loss to Manchester United in the FA Cup on Friday last week and this must have given Unai Emery a big headache since Sokratis who is a defender had also got injured in the same match. The Frenchman had swelling on his jaw but the club has confirmed that he is now back in training ahead of their upcoming match against second placed Manchester City.
Ainsley Maitland-Niles missed Arsenal’s match against Cardiff City on Tuesday because he had a knee problem before the game, but he is currently being assessed ahead of the Manchester City game. Arsenal boss Unai Emery will need Maitland-Niles to be fit for the game because Hector Bellerin has been ruled out for the rest of the season.
Arsenal boss Unai Emery will definitely feel relieved that the gunners will be with Laurent Koscielny and Ainsley Maitland-Niles on Sunday because Manchester City has many attacking threats that will definitely give the gunners a hard time.
